
A 100K Long Ride Across the Pingtung Plain: A Rural Route Through Tropical Orchards and Hakka Villages
While most cyclists set their sights on Taiwan’s mountain routes, the Pingtung Plain quietly awaits with its own unique charm. There are no suffocating climbs here; instead, you’ll find endless rice paddies, betel nut orchards stretching to the horizon, mango trees heavy with fruit, and Hakka settlements scattered across the fields. A 100-kilometer long ride across the Pingtung Plain is a journey to measure Taiwan’s agricultural heartland by wheel.
Route Overview
- Start/End Point: Pingtung Railway Station
- Total Distance: Approximately 105 km
- Total Elevation Gain: Approximately 200 m (almost entirely flat)
- Difficulty: ★★☆☆☆ (Fitness) / ★☆☆☆☆ (Technical)
- Estimated Time: 5 to 7 hours (including rest stops)
- Best Time to Ride: Depart at dawn to avoid the afternoon heat
Route Planning: Counterclockwise Loop
Segment 1: Pingtung City → Wandan → Xinyuan (25 km)
Terrain: Completely flat
Scenery: Rice paddies, red bean fields, and irrigation canals
Departing from Pingtung Railway Station, head south through Pingtung City. Shortly after leaving the urban area, you’ll enter farmland. Wandan Township is Taiwan’s main red bean producing area, and during winter (December–January) you can see fields of red beans. The irrigation canal system along the way is an engineering project left from the Japanese colonial era, with clear water flowing through the fields.
Wandan’s most famous foods are red bean cakes and Wandan beef noodles. If you set off early, this is the first good spot to grab breakfast.
Supplies: Convenience stores and a traditional market in Wandan’s town center; small shops in Xinyuan Township.
Segment 2: Xinyuan → Donggang → Linbian (25 km)
Terrain: Flat
Scenery: Fishing harbors, aquaculture ponds, and bluefin tuna culture
Heading south from Xinyuan toward the coastline, Donggang is one of Taiwan’s most important offshore fishing harbors. The annual bluefin tuna season from April to June is the liveliest time in Donggang. The seafood at Huaqiao Market (Donggang Fish Harbor Direct Sales Center) is affordable and delicious—sailfish tempura and sakura shrimp fried rice are must-try snacks.
Continuing south to Linbian, you’ll pass vast aquaculture ponds. Linbian once suffered from severe land subsidence, but in recent years it has focused on developing agrivoltaics, with solar panels installed above the fish ponds, creating a unique landscape.
Supplies: Donggang’s town center has abundant dining options; convenience stores near Linbian Railway Station.
Segment 3: Linbian → Chaozhou (20 km)
Terrain: Flat with slight undulations
Scenery: Wax apple orchards, cocoa plantations
Turning inland from Linbian toward Chaozhou, this stretch passes through the most productive tropical fruit-growing region of Pingtung County. Pingtung is Taiwan’s largest wax apple producing area, and rows of wax apple orchards along the roadside hang heavy with crimson fruit during the harvest season (May–July). In recent years, Pingtung has also developed a cocoa-growing industry, with some farms offering chocolate-making experiences—worth scheduling a stop if time allows.
Chaozhou Township is Pingtung County’s second-largest city, with well-developed amenities. Chaozhou cold-hot ice is the area’s most famous dessert: hot glutinous rice balls and hot peanuts are placed over shaved ice, and the unique contrast of cold and hot is worth trying.
Supplies: Convenience stores, restaurants, and snack shops in Chaozhou’s town center. Recommended: Chaozhou cold-hot ice.
Segment 4: Chaozhou → Wanluan → Neipu (20 km)
Terrain: Gentle rolling hills, near the foothills
Scenery: Hakka settlements, Pig’s Knuckle Street, tobacco drying houses
This stretch enters the heart of Pingtung’s Hakka settlements. Wanluan Township is famous throughout Taiwan for its pig’s knuckle, and the dozens of shops along Wanluan Pig’s Knuckle Street each have their own character—this is a major food stop on the journey. We recommend trying the authentic Wanluan pig’s knuckle at long-established restaurants such as Hai Hong Hotel or Lin Jia Pig’s Knuckle.
On the country roads from Wanluan to Neipu, you can see well-preserved Hakka tobacco drying houses (buildings once used for curing tobacco leaves) and traditional Hakka farmhouses (three-sided courtyard homes). These century-old buildings bear witness to the history of Hakka ancestors reclaiming the Pingtung Plain. Neipu Old Street preserves a cluster of traditional Hakka architecture, and Changli Temple (the only temple in Taiwan dedicated to Han Yu) is worth a visit.
Supplies: Wanluan Pig’s Knuckle Street (top choice for lunch); convenience stores in Neipu’s town center.
Segment 5: Neipu → Changzhi → Pingtung City (15 km)
Terrain: Flat
Scenery: Betel nut orchards and an industrial transition zone
The final stretch returns from Neipu to Pingtung City via Changzhi. The scenery along this section is relatively monotonous, passing through a mixed agricultural-industrial area, but the distance is short—just right for a cool-down ride. Back in Pingtung City, you can round off the journey with local snacks at the Pingtung Night Market.
Supplies: Convenience stores in Changzhi’s town center; Pingtung City has full supply options.
Climate and Riding Season
The Pingtung Plain has a tropical climate with high temperatures year-round. Managing your body temperature while riding is crucial:
| Month | Average Temperature | Rainfall | Riding Recommendation |
|---|---|---|---|
| Jan–Feb | 18–25°C | Low | Best season, cool and comfortable |
| Mar–Apr | 22–28°C | Low | Comfortable, small temperature difference between day and night |
| May–Jun | 26–32°C | Plum rain | Watch out for rain |
| Jul–Sep | 28–35°C | Afternoon thunderstorms | Depart at dawn, finish before noon |
| Oct–Dec | 22–28°C | Low | Comfortable, occasional downslope winds |
Heat Prevention Tips
- In summer, be sure to depart before 5:30 AM
- Hydrate every 20 minutes; don’t wait until you’re thirsty
- Wear light-colored moisture-wicking jerseys and use sun-protection arm sleeves
- Carry electrolyte supplements (sports drink powder or salt tablets)
- At convenience stores, don’t just buy water—pair it with a sodium-containing sports drink
Gear Recommendations
For a 100 km flat ride, the gear focus is on comfort and sun protection:
- Bike: A road bike or flat-bar road bike is most suitable; a mountain bike works but will be slower
- Saddle: Long flat rides demand a lot from the saddle—make sure you use one that fits you
- Cycling shorts: Essential; riding for hours without padded shorts will be painful
- Bottles: At least two (750 ml each); convenience stores along the way allow refills
- Sun protection: Helmet visor insert, sunglasses, sun-protection arm sleeves, sunscreen
- Portable snacks: Bananas, rice balls, energy gels
Why Ride the Pingtung Plain
Taiwan’s cycling culture often glorifies “climbing heroes,” and flat riding seems to lack appeal. But a 100K long ride across the Pingtung Plain has its own unique value: it trains sustained, steady power output and tests your ability to maintain rhythm without the respite of descents. More importantly, riding on the plain lets you truly “see” this land—rice stalks swaying in the wind, fruit farmers working in their orchards, Hakka women drying radish strips in front of their courtyard homes. These are sights you’ll never see while hunched over climbing a mountain.
Bring your bike to the Pingtung Plain, and at the speed best suited to this land, take a slow, long ride.
